Kira Morgan built her career on controlling the narrative. As one of the most sought-after crisis communications experts in the country, she knows exactly how truth gets shaped, buried, and rewritten, which is why the assignment should have been simple: help contain the fallout from a leaked government project involving memory manipulation technology.
But the deeper Kira digs, the more the story stops making sense. The system is too sophisticated. The architecture too familiar. And when she finally breaches its core, she doesn't find a stranger's fingerprints on the code.
She finds her own.
Now Kira is racing to understand a system she has no memory of creating, while a man with no name and no traceable past closes in, someone whose reach into her history runs far deeper than surveillance. As the lines between what she remembers and what was engineered begin to dissolve, Kira must decide who she can trust when she can no longer trust her own mind.
The Echo Conspiracy is a psychological thriller about the fragility of memory, the machinery of institutional truth, and what happens when the person controlling the narrative discovers she's also the one who's been controlled.
For readers who loved The Girl on the Train, Recursion, and Dark Matter. The Echo Conspiracy is a novel that asks: if you can't trust what you remember, can you trust who you are?
